Safety


Safety, Free SVG Cut Files

For someone who spends a lot of time driving, safety should be a top priority. A dash cam can provide peace of mind in the event of an accident, a first-aid kit can be essential for treating minor injuries, and a roadside safety kit can provide the tools and supplies needed to stay safe in the event of a breakdown or other emergency.

  • Peace of Mind: A dash cam can provide peace of mind by recording footage of the road ahead, which can be helpful in the event of an accident. This footage can be used to prove fault, determine liability, and even exonerate the driver in the event of a false accusation.
  • Preparedness: A first-aid kit can be essential for treating minor injuries that may occur while driving, such as cuts, scrapes, and burns. It can also be used to provide first aid to other motorists or pedestrians in the event of an accident.
  • Emergency Assistance: A roadside safety kit can provide the tools and supplies needed to stay safe in the event of a breakdown or other emergency. This kit may include items such as jumper cables, a tire repair kit, a flashlight, and a first-aid kit.

Safety gifts for someone who drives a lot can provide peace of mind, preparedness, and emergency assistance. By providing these essential items, you can help to keep your loved ones safe on the road.

Tech


Tech, Free SVG Cut Files

In today’s world, technology is increasingly becoming a part of our driving experience. From hands-free calling to GPS navigation, there are a number of tech gadgets that can make driving safer, more convenient, and more enjoyable.

For someone who spends a lot of time behind the wheel, a tech gift can be a thoughtful and practical choice. Here are a few ideas:

  • Heads-up display: A heads-up display (HUD) projects important information, such as speed, navigation, and incoming calls, onto the windshield. This allows drivers to keep their eyes on the road while staying informed.
  • Rear-seat entertainment system: A rear-seat entertainment system can keep passengers entertained on long road trips. These systems typically include a DVD player, a monitor, and headphones.
  • Voice-activated assistant: A voice-activated assistant can help drivers to stay connected and entertained without taking their hands off the wheel. These assistants can be used to make calls, send messages, play music, and get directions.

When choosing a tech gift for someone who drives a lot, it is important to consider their individual needs and preferences. For example, if they have a long commute, they might appreciate a heads-up display or a voice-activated assistant. If they have children, they might prefer a rear-seat entertainment system.

Experiential


Experiential, Free SVG Cut Files

Experiential gifts are a great way to show someone you care about their interests and hobbies. For someone who loves to drive, a driving lesson, a track day, or a road trip to a scenic destination can be the perfect gift. These experiences can help them to improve their driving skills, learn new techniques, and explore their passion for driving in a fun and exciting way.

Driving lessons can be a great way for someone to improve their driving skills, learn new techniques, and gain confidence behind the wheel. There are a variety of driving lessons available, from basic lessons for beginners to advanced lessons for experienced drivers. Track days are a great way for someone to experience the thrill of driving on a race track. These events are typically held at racetracks and allow participants to drive their own cars on the track in a controlled environment. Road trips are a great way for someone to explore their passion for driving and see new parts of the country. There are many scenic road trips available, from coastal drives to mountain passes.

When choosing an experiential gift for someone who loves to drive, it is important to consider their individual interests and experience level. For example, if they are a beginner driver, a basic driving lesson might be the best choice. If they are an experienced driver, they might enjoy a track day or a road trip to a scenic destination.
